Subject: Mail room relocation — week of the 14th

Hi all,

From Monday the mail room at Fennick Court moves from the ground floor to Level 2, next to the print hub. Couriers will be redirected automatically, but internal post trays need collecting by Friday afternoon. The new room is on the secure corridor, so assistants picking up parcels will need the door code, which is shown below.

staff pass of kagup-fajog = bdg-QCHVQW-99665837

Finance Review Summary — Support Outsourcing Plan

The proposal to transfer tier-one customer support from our Velmora branches to Quillhaven Services has been assessed in detail. Projected annual savings stand at 14%, though transition costs in the first two quarters will offset roughly half of that. Service-level guarantees were reviewed and found adequate, pending contract amendments on escalation handling. Branch managers should prepare staffing impact statements by month-end. The note below outlines the strategic rationale for this move.

board note of baweg-bawig: Project Tamath slips by six weeks because of the audit delay.

The setting SPAN_EXPORT_KEYED has been renamed to TRACE_EXPORT_MODE. This affects how request traces propagate across the Orlix microservices; the old name is no longer read, so customers on self-hosted installs who keep the old key will see broken cross-service correlation, not an error. When assisting upgrades, have them edit the collector's env file: remove the old line, add TRACE_EXPORT_MODE=propagate, and then, because the exporter now authenticates to the trace sink, the very next line should be:

sealed setting: LEDGER_TOKEN8=d7bed4fd

# Rateguard settings — hotel rate-parity checker.
# Scans partner feeds hourly and flags rooms where the Bramblehost
# storefront undercuts our published rate. Release manager: bump
# SCAN_VERSION on every deploy or the comparator reuses stale
# snapshots. Thresholds live in parity_rules.yaml; don't edit here.
# The checker persists mismatch reports to the parity database,
# reachable via the connection string on the next line.

replica DSN, tawef-hahap: mysql://eliix_svc:FiIC0jz@db-394a.lumiclabs.internal:5432/holius